We arrived late christmas day at the house and travelling through the town were in awe of the christmas decorations there. It attracts hundreds of people at christmas as the residents decorate their houses from head to toe with lights and decorations. Some houses even have their houses decorated so that the lights flicker on and off to a specific radio station.  There is also snow at regular time in the town centre,..SNOW IN FLORIDA!!!!!!!! It is the strangest place on earth but I can think of no place nicer to spend the holiday season.
